When selecting a Bitcoin trading website, there are several crucial factors to consider:


1. Security: One of the most important aspects is the security level provided by the platform. It should employ advanced encryption methods and secure login protocols to protect users' wallets from hackers and other malicious actors.


2. Fees: Trading websites often charge fees for their services, including withdrawal and deposit fees, trading fees, and others. Users need to compare these fees across different platforms to find the best value.


3. Liquidity: Liquidity refers to how easy it is to buy or sell cryptocurrencies on a platform without significantly affecting the market price. High liquidity indicates that trades can be executed quickly and at minimal cost.


4. User Interface (UI) and Experience: A good trading website should offer an intuitive user interface that makes navigation easy, even for first-time users. The experience should also provide comprehensive educational resources to help users make informed decisions.


5. Regulatory Compliance: Regulations governing cryptocurrencies are still evolving, and platforms need to ensure they comply with the laws of their regions. Users prefer platforms that have transparent compliance policies.


6. Customer Support: Good customer support is essential for resolving any issues or queries users may have while using the platform. Availability through multiple channels (e.g., live chat, email) and quick response times are key indicators of good service.
